Title :
OFDM code division multiplexing with unequal error protection and flexible data rate adaptation

Abstract :
An OFDM-CDM (orthogonal frequency division multiplexing code division multiplexing) system with adaptive symbol mapping is presented. This combination enables a robust transmission with flexible error protection and data rate adaptation for parallel data streams by exploiting additional diversity due to CDM. Performance results are presented for fading channels where OFDM-CDM with adaptive symbol mapping and soft interference cancellation is compared to conventional OFDM systems also taking into account channel coding with variable code rates
